1

によって作成/コミットされたコミットが表示された場合John Doe <jdoe@gmail.com>、どの GitHub ユーザーがこのコミットを私の GitHub:Enterprise リポジトリにプッシュしたかを知る方法はありますか (書き込みアクセス権を持つユーザーが多数いると仮定します)?

4

2 に答える 2

1

少し手間がかかりますが、ご存知かもしれませんが、Github REST Apiがあります。セットアップ (シングル ユーザーかエンタープライズか) に応じて、リポジトリのユーザー情報を取得するための適切なリソースが見つかる場合があります。そこから、どの github ユーザーがコミットしたかを推定できます。

于 2014-08-22T23:07:07.720 に答える
0

この機能は GitHub Enterprise UI (バージョン 11.10.343 を参照) に存在します ... 管理者の場合:

  1. 管理者レベルのユーザーとして、問題のリポジトリに移動します
  2. 画面右上のロケットアイコン(管理ツール)をクリック
  3. 左側のナビゲーションで、[プッシュ ログ] をクリックします。

その画面には「プッシュ ログのコピー」ボタンが表示されるので、管理者でない場合は、管理者にリクエストできる場合があります。

于 2014-09-18T00:28:31.083 に答える